Where to stay in Old Town Albuquerque

Find the best Old Town Albuquerque are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most.

Northeast Heights

While visiting Northeast Heights, you might make a stop by sights like iT'Z Albuquerque and ABQ Uptown.

Downtown Albuquerque

Central business district with highrise buildings, Downtown Albuquerque offers shopping, dining, and nightlife along Central and Gold Avenues. Explore landmarks like KiMo Theater and enjoy convenient public transit options.

Balloon Fiesta Park - North I-25

If you're spending some time in Balloon Fiesta Park - North I-25, Anderson-Abruzzo Albuquerque International Balloon Museum and Cliff's Amusement Park are top sights worth seeing.

Westside

Westside is popular for its ample dining options, and you might make a stop by Rio Grande, a top place to visit in the area.

North Valley

You'll enjoy the mountain views and breweries in North Valley. You might want to make time for a stop at Los Poblanos Open Space or Rio Grande.

Best time to go to Old Town Albuquerque

The best time to visit Old Town Albuquerque is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is sunny with no rain.

What is there to do around this Albuquerque neighborhood?
Attractions like Albuquerque Museum, New Mexico Museum of Natural History and Science, and American International Rattlesnake Museum highlight Albuquerque's cultural scene. Old Town Plaza and Fermin Hernandez Fine Art Gallery are also a couple of places to visit in the neighborhood. Amapola Gallery, Nizhoni Gallery, and Atomic Museum are just a few of the places to visit in and around Old Town Albuquerque. While you're out sightseeing, Turquoise Museum and Explora Science Center and Children's Museum are a couple of additional sights to visit in Albuquerque.
